The Loops 14 Litre Oil Dispensing Unit is designed for efficient and convenient oil transfer, ideal for both DIY mechanics and professional workshops. Its key benefit lies in the self-priming lever pump and generous 14L capacity, minimizing manual effort and refill frequency. A minor consideration is its suitability for oils up to SAE 40 viscosity, which may not cover extremely thick lubricants.

FAQs

What types of oil can be used with this dispenser?

The unit is suitable for oils up to SAE 40 viscosity, commonly used in automotive and workshop applications.

How do I prime the pump?

The lever pump is self-priming. Simply operate the lever a few times to draw oil into the system.

What is the length of the delivery hose?

The delivery hose is 1.8 meters long.

Is the unit suitable for dispensing hot oil?

The product specifications do not mention suitability for hot oil. It is recommended to use at ambient temperatures for safety and optimal performance.

How should I clean the dispensing unit?

Wipe the exterior with a damp cloth. For internal cleaning, flush with a lighter, compatible oil and dispense it out.

What is the net weight of the unit?

The net weight of the 14 Litre Oil Dispensing Unit is 5.51kg.

Troubleshooting

Pump is difficult to operate.

Ensure the oil viscosity is within the SAE 40 limit. Check for any blockages in the intake or delivery hose.

Unit leaks during operation.

Verify that all hose connections are secure and tight. Inspect the pump mechanism and reservoir for any cracks or damage.

Oil is not being dispensed.

Confirm the unit is properly primed. Ensure the intake is submerged in the oil and the delivery hose is not kinked or blocked.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up:

  1. Unpack all components and ensure everything is present.
  2. Attach the 1.8m delivery hose to the dispensing unit if not pre-assembled.
  3. Place the unit on a stable, level surface, utilizing the foot plate for added stability.

Compatibility:

  • Suitable for oils with viscosity up to SAE 40.
  • Not recommended for use with water, solvents, or corrosive fluids.

Care:

  • After each use, clean the exterior with a damp cloth.
  • If transferring different types of oil, it is recommended to flush the unit with a compatible lighter oil to prevent contamination.
  • Store in a dry place, ensuring the cover is securely fitted to keep dust and debris out.
